Granny flats, in-law suites — ADUs by any name can make towns stronger

September 1, 2020
Accessory dwelling units (ADUs) are gaining momentum across the country. The backyard apartments — sometimes known as guest quarters, casitas, carriage houses, in-law suites, or granny flats — can ease housing shortages and boost density in residential neighborhoods that are downtown or adjacent to downtown areas. Historical Figure Sparks Downtown Revival

June 6, 2024
Macomb, IL, is a little city whose leaders freely admit it’s in the middle of nowhere. These days, they’re making a big claim: The downtown is now home to the world’s largest Monopoly board. Project rejected? Maybe you need to prove it’ll work

February 1, 2021
When the city of Somerville, MA (est. pop. 81,358), proposed transforming a small public parking lot into a public plaza, a handful of skeptical residents nixed the idea. So the city decided to take a different approach to pitching the placemaking initiative: Somerville officials transformed the 10-spot lot into a pop-up park. City uses food trucks to combat crime

May 1, 2023
Albuquerque, NM (est. pop. 562,591), is trying a novel approach to quelling crime in a problematic area downtown: It’s bringing in food trucks.
